Re: Saw this at the local supermarket...anyone ever use it?
"Red Star® PLATINUM performs best in recipes that contain sugar and is certified Kosher parve under the rabbinical supervision of KOF-K."
"*Red Star® PLATINUM is NOT gluten free because the dough improvers are derived from wheat flour. NOTE: For gluten free bakers, you can continue to use Red Star® Active Dry Yeast or Red Star® Quick Rise Yeast."
The above from the koshereye website.. It likes recipes with sugar hmmm anyone know any recipes with sugar?
